Searched refs:ExtensionRAIIObject (Results 1 - 6 of 6) sorted by relevance

/external/clang/lib/Parse/
H A DRAIIObjectsForParser.h242 /// ExtensionRAIIObject - This saves the state of extension warnings when
246 class ExtensionRAIIObject { class in namespace:clang
247 ExtensionRAIIObject(const ExtensionRAIIObject &) LLVM_DELETED_FUNCTION;
248 void operator=(const ExtensionRAIIObject &) LLVM_DELETED_FUNCTION;
252 ExtensionRAIIObject(DiagnosticsEngine &diags) : Diags(diags) { function in class:clang::ExtensionRAIIObject
256 ~ExtensionRAIIObject() {
H A DParseExpr.cpp144 ExtensionRAIIObject O(Diags);
896 ExtensionRAIIObject O(Diags); // Use RAII to do this.
H A DParseStmt.cpp961 ExtensionRAIIObject O(Diags);
H A DParser.cpp654 ExtensionRAIIObject O(Diags); // Use RAII to do this.
H A DParseDeclCXX.cpp2086 ExtensionRAIIObject O(Diags); // Use RAII to do this.
H A DParseDecl.cpp3226 ExtensionRAIIObject O(Diags); // Use RAII to do this.

Completed in 275 milliseconds